This two day training course is designed for new project managers or those wishing to refresh their project management skills. Based upon PMI®’s PMBOK®, Alluvionic’s Project Management Fundamentals is broken into six topics of Scope Management, Schedule Management, Cost Management, Risk Management, Change Management, and Team Management. Taught by a PMI® ATP through a combination of interactive lectures, group discussions, and practical exercises, participants will learn how to apply project management techniques to effectively meet project goals and gain the knowledge and skills to successfully manage projects in their professional roles.

Alluvionic’s two day course, Risk Management Fundamentals, provides participants with a comprehensive understanding of risk management principles and best practices to gain the knowledge to effectively manage risks in their professional careers. The course, based on the PMI® Standard for Risk Management in Portfolios, Programs, and Projects, and PMBOK® covers topics such as Risk Identification, Analysis, Response Planning, and Monitoring and Control. A PMI® ATP will instruct you on seven risk management processes, Plan Risk Management, Identify Risks, Perform Qualitative Risk Analysis, Plan Risk Responses, Implement Risk Responses, and Monitor Risks.

This four-day training course is for students seeking to earn their Project Management Professional (PMP)® certification or Certified Associate in Project Management (CAPM)® certification from the Project Management Institute (PMI)®. The course is based upon A Guide to the Project Management Body of Knowledge (PMBOK® Guide) and the PMI® Authorized PMP® Exam Prep study guide. The course is organized into five lessons on Creating a High-Performing Team, Starting the Project, Doing the Work, Keeping the Team on Track, and Keeping the Business in Mind. In-class exercises are used to reinforce learning, and an online practice test platform is used to simulate sitting for the PMP® certification exam. Students who successfully complete the course earn 35 PDUs.

This two-day training course is for experienced project managers who are seeking to enhance their power skills. The course is based upon a variety of academic sources and is consistent with A Guide to the Project Management Body of Knowledge (PMBOK® Guide). It is organized into the following nine topics: leadership, motivation, organizational change management, communication skills, power and influence, negotiation and conflict resolution, teamwork, and emotional intelligence. In-class exercises are used to reinforce learning. Participants who successfully complete the course earn 15 Professional Development Units (PDUs).
